• Neutering aid for 5 dogs in Cheras and Balakong (Tong Yut Fun’s) & Updates

    We have provided a full sponsorship of RM860 for the neutering of these 5 dogs. The charges were RM150 each for 2 male dogs, RM180 each for 2 female dogs and RM200 for another female dog at a different clinic. JoTong covered the boarding charges herself.   • Another morning with Gerald and Misty!

    Gerald and Misty are our only CNRM (as in R=Return-to-colony) street cats. The rest are all indoors (R=Rehome to own home!) because of the neighbours and the neighbourhood. We always advise that if our neighbourhood or the colony is not street animal-friendly, then it is our responsibility to keep our neutered animals safe either by…
